Finding 01
The ADHD screener flags almost everyone — two cautions on reading it
The survey included a standard six-item adult ADHD screener. On paper the result looks dramatic: eleven of twelve answered above the positive cut-off. Taken at face value that would suggest an almost universal attention disorder — which is not something a screen alone can tell us.
Splitting the screener by item is where care is needed. It touches two different things: an attention & follow-through side (finishing tasks, staying organised, remembering, avoiding heavy thinking) and a hyperactive side (restlessness, feeling driven). Across the group, the first side is near the ceiling and the second is almost flat.
The first caution is overlap. Those four attention items closely resemble the cognitive fatigue and brain fog described in ME/CFS and Long COVID. In a group living with ELC, high marks on them are expected, and a high screening score can reflect the illness rather than a lifelong attention difference.
The second caution matters especially for a group of women, and it points the other way. It is tempting to read the near-empty hyperactive pole as a sign this is not “real” ADHD. That reading is a trap. In girls and women, ADHD far more often takes a quiet, inattentive form — with little of the visible restlessness the stereotype is built on — and it is precisely this quieter presentation that gets overlooked, so many reach adulthood undiagnosed, frequently labelled with anxiety or depression first (Hinshaw et al., 2021; Martin et al., 2024). A low hyperactivity score tells us little either way.
Which is one reason questionnaires like these ask about more than current symptoms — including whether anything was noticeable in childhood.
Finding 02
Childhood onset: one factor the questionnaire looks at, not a cause it can settle
The ADHD screener also asks, separately, whether attention, restlessness, or trouble staying organised were already noticeable before age 12. An early start is one of the features clinicians weigh. It is not something a questionnaire can confirm, and memories of childhood are imperfect — so this is a descriptive signal, not a diagnosis or a cause.
One general point is worth holding here. When you first notice a trait and when it actually began can be very different. An illness can hand someone the words for something that was there all along — so noticing a trait after ELC does not mean it started then. That is a reason to be gentle with quick conclusions, in either direction.
Finding 03
The autism screener divides the group
The second tool, a fourteen-item autism-spectrum screener, behaves differently from the ADHD one. Rather than catching almost everyone, it fell roughly evenly: six of twelve answered above the threshold. Scoring above a screening threshold does not establish an autism diagnosis or a lifelong profile — it is a prompt to learn more, nothing more.
What is useful here is a design detail: each trait is marked not just present or absent, but when it has been true — since childhood, only now, or only earlier in life. At the group level this is what the chart at the top of the page shows: both patterns are present, some traits long-standing and some noticed recently. That is a description of the group, not a statement about anyone in it.
The timing members reported about themselves and the trait-by-trait tags broadly lined up at the group level — which is what you would expect if the timing question is capturing something consistent. With a small, self-selected group this stays descriptive, and none of it points to a cause.
Finding 04
Sensory sensitivity is a common thread
One experience cut across the group. Raised sensory sensitivity — textures that feel offensive on the skin, a need to cover the ears or retreat from noise and light, having to withdraw to shut the senses down — was reported by nine of twelve, among those above and below the autism threshold alike.
It is offered here simply as a frequently shared, self-reported experience worth naming — not a measurement and not a sign of any condition. For many people, recognising sensory load as real, and giving it room, is a small relief in itself.
